Object-oriented analysis and design of educational content
This paper presents educational content of the vocational education and education at all as a broad information system. The authors point out the absence of formalization in educational content notation analysis and design on the contrary of other fields, where modeling plays irreplaceable role. For modeling this information system they use Unified Modeling Language UML, which is specialized language for system specification primarily in object-oriented manner. The paper further refers to a parallel between object-oriented analysis and design OOAN and object-oriented didactical transformation OODT. Modeling in OODT context leads to models with zero redundancy in educational content which represents so called basic curriculum. Identifying that basic curriculum is still unresolved and discussed because the pedagogical theory hasn't defined methodology for explicit expression of the basic curriculum yet.
